加密对话游戏,如何玩转现代密码学加密对话游戏怎么玩不了
本文目录导读:
在当今数字化时代,信息的保密性和安全性已成为人类文明发展的重要基石,从军事战略到商业竞争,从个人隐私到国家机密,密码学始终扮演着关键的角色,而加密对话游戏作为一种新兴的密码学应用形式,不仅改变了我们与信息世界的交互方式,也为人类社会的未来发展提供了新的可能,本文将深入探讨加密对话游戏的原理、应用以及未来发展方向,带您一起领略现代密码学的魅力。
密码学的基石:加密对话的基本原理
加密对话游戏的核心在于实现信息的保密传输,在信息论和数论的基础上,现代密码学构建了一套严密的理论体系,加密对话游戏的基本流程可以分为以下几个步骤:
-
密钥生成:游戏的一方(通常为Alice)首先生成一对密钥,包括公钥和私钥,公钥可以被任何人获取,而私钥必须由Alice自己保管。
-
信息加密:当Alice收到一条需要保密的信息时,她会使用Bob的公钥对信息进行加密,这种加密过程确保只有持有对应私钥的Bob才能解密信息。
-
信息传输:加密后的信息通过不可靠的信道(如互联网)传递给Bob。
-
信息解密:Bob收到加密信息后,使用自己的私钥进行解密,恢复出原文。
这一过程看似简单,但其背后的数学原理却非常复杂,RSA加密算法的安全性依赖于大整数分解的困难性,而椭圆曲线加密则利用了椭圆曲线上的离散对数问题,这些数学难题确保了加密对话的安全性。
零知识证明:让对话更高效
零知识证明(Zero-Knowledge Proof,ZKP)是现代密码学中的一个重要概念,它允许一方(Prover)向另一方(Verifier)证明自己拥有某种信息,而无需透露该信息的具体内容,这种特性在加密对话游戏中具有广泛的应用。
-
信息验证:在加密对话游戏中,Prover可以通过ZKP向Verifier证明自己拥有某种信息(如密码),而无需实际传输该信息,这种验证过程是完全透明的,Verifier无法获取任何额外信息。
-
隐私保护:ZKP的特性使得加密对话游戏中的参与者可以保持高度的隐私,在一个加密对话游戏中,Alice可以向Bob证明她知道某个秘密,而无需透露该秘密的具体内容。
-
高效通信:通过ZKP,双方可以在不共享大量信息的情况下完成验证过程,这种高效性使得加密对话游戏在实际应用中更具可行性。
加密对话游戏的实际应用
区块链中的隐私保护
区块链技术的不可篡改性和分布式账本特性使其成为加密对话游戏的理想载体,通过结合ZKP,区块链可以实现高度私密的交易记录。
在Zcash这种隐私币中,用户可以通过ZKP证明自己已支付资金,而无需透露具体的金额和来源,这种特性极大地保护了用户的隐私。
电子投票系统的安全性和隐私性
在电子投票系统中,确保投票的隐私性和不可篡改性是至关重要的,通过结合加密对话游戏和ZKP,可以构建一个高度安全和私密的投票系统。
-
投票隐私:每个选民可以通过ZKP证明其选票的合法性,而无需透露具体选择的内容。
-
投票不可篡改:通过加密对话游戏,选民可以验证其投票是否被正确记录,而无需依赖第三方的监督。
-
系统透明:整个投票过程可以在区块链上透明记录,确保系统的公正性和可监督性。
医疗数据的安全共享
在医疗领域,数据的安全性和隐私性是最高级别的要求,通过加密对话游戏和ZKP,可以实现医疗数据的私密共享和分析。
-
数据共享:医疗机构可以通过加密对话游戏共享患者数据,而无需泄露患者的具体信息。
-
数据安全:通过ZKP,数据共享方可以验证数据的完整性,而无需泄露数据的具体内容。
-
数据隐私:患者的数据在传输过程中始终处于加密状态,确保其隐私不被泄露。
加密对话游戏的未来展望
随着密码学技术的不断发展,加密对话游戏的应用场景将不断扩展,以下是一些值得期待的未来发展方向:
-
量子-resistant加密:随着量子计算机的出现,传统加密算法的安全性将受到严重威胁,开发量子-resistant加密算法和零知识证明方案,将为未来的加密对话游戏提供坚实的安全保障。
-
多参与者的零知识证明:目前的零知识证明主要适用于两方之间的验证过程,支持多方参与的零知识证明将更加广泛地应用于加密对话游戏。
-
区块链与加密对话的结合:随着区块链技术的成熟,其与加密对话游戏的结合将推动密码学应用的新突破,结合ZKP的去中心化金融(DeFi)平台将为用户带来更加私密和安全的交易体验。
加密对话游戏作为现代密码学的重要组成部分,不仅改变了我们与信息世界的交互方式,也为人类社会的未来发展提供了新的可能,从零知识证明到隐私保护,从区块链到DeFi,加密对话游戏的应用场景将不断扩展,随着密码学技术的不断发展,我们有理由相信,加密对话游戏将成为保障人类信息安全的重要工具,为人类文明的发展提供更加坚实的安全保障。
加密对话游戏,如何玩转现代密码学加密对话游戏怎么玩不了,
发表评论